
UAE President, Armenian Prime Minister discuss bilateral relations
ABU DHABI (WAM)UAE President His Highness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an Wednesday received Nikol Pashinyan, Prime Minister of the Republic of Armenia, who is on a working visit to the UAE.The meeting took place at Qasr Al Shati in Abu Dhabi, where His Highness welcomed the Armenian Prime Minister and his accompanying delegation, and conveyed his best wishes for continued prosperity and wellbeing to the people of Armenia.During the meeting, His Highness and the Prime Minister discussed ways to strengthen bilateral cooperation across various fields, with a particular focus on the economic, investment, and development sectors in a manner that serves the shared interests of both countries, and contributes to the progress and prosperity of their peoples.The two sides also exchanged views on a number of regional and international issues of mutual concern.In this context, His Highness expressed the UAE's support for all efforts aimed at reinforcing stability and security across the Caucasus region. He emphasised the UAE's longstanding approach of supporting peace and security, at both the regional and global levels, through dialogue and diplomacy.
His Highness also reaffirmed the UAE's commitment to working closely with the Republic of Armenia to advance mutual development and prosperity, and to support the aspirations of both nations toward sustainable growth.
The Armenian Prime Minister thanked His Highness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ed for his continued support in strengthening bilateral relations, and he affirmed Armenia's keenness to further develop cooperation across all fields.The meeting was attended by His Highness Sheikh Abdullah bin Zayed Al Nahyan, UAE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s; His Highness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an, Deputy Chairman of the Presidential Court for Special Affairs; Ali bin Hammad Al Shamsi, Secretary-General of Supreme Council for National Security; Ahmed bin Ali Al Sayegh, UAE Minister of State; Dr. Ahmed Mubarak Al Mazrouei, Chairman of the President's Office for Strategic Affairs and Chairman of the Abu Dhabi Executive Office; Lana Nusseibeh, Assistant of Minister of Foreign Affairs for Political Affairs; Dr. Nariman Al Mulla, Ambassador of the UAE to the Republic of Armenia; and several senior officials.Also present was the accompanying delegation of the Armenian Prime Minister, which included a number of ministers and senior officials.
Upon his arrival at Abu Dhabi's Presidential Airport earlier in the day, the Armenian Prime Minister was received by His Highness Sheikh Abdullah bin Zayed Al Nahyan, UAE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s, along with several senior officials.

UAE Launches AI-Powered System to Elevate Government Efficiency
His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President, Prime Minister, and Ruler of Dubai, has launched the Proactive Government Performance System—an AI-powered platform designed to elevate government efficiency and align with the 'We the UAE 2031' national vision. Unveiled in the presence of senior officials, including Sheikh Ahmed b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um and Ministers Mohammad Al Gergawi and Omar Sultan Al Olama, the system uses artificial intelligence and advanced analytics to translate strategic goals into measurable outcomes. It is expected to significantly boost decision-making, resource use, service quality, and transparency across federal entities. The platform processes over 150 million data points monthly, delivers more than 50,000 proactive insights annually, and saves an estimated 250,000 work hours each year. It also enhances performance measurement by 45 times and improves self-management capabilities within government bodies by 90%. Sheikh Mohammed reaffirmed the UAE's commitment to excellence, stating that the new system is a major step forward in anticipating challenges and seizing opportunities through data-driven governance. Evolving from the original Adaa system introduced in 2008, this fourth-generation model marks a shift toward predictive performance management. With real-time data flow, integrated reporting, and rigorous benchmarking, it fosters innovation and continuous improvement while reinforcing public trust and accountability. Preparations for 2026 UN Water Conference accelerate with adoption of six interactive dialogue themes
10 July 2025 09:35 NEW YORK (WAM) At a high-level preparatory meeting convened by the President of the United Nations General Assembly, Member States formally adopted, by consensus, the themes of the six interactive dialogues of the 2026 United Nations Water Conference (2026 UNWC), held in the United Arab Emirates in December next adoption marks a pivotal milestone in the lead-up to the 2026 UNWC, which aims to elevate the global water agenda and catalyse collective action and ambitions on water-related challenges. As the first UN conference focused on accelerating progress toward Sustainable Development Goal 6 (ensuring availability and sustainable management of water and sanitation for all), the 2026 UNWC presents a vital opportunity to drive meaningful, global 2024, the United Arab Emirates and the Republic of Senegal, as co-hosts of the 2026 Conference, have led a robust, inclusive consultation process involving Member States and various stakeholders, including international organisations, civil society organisations, NGOs, the private sector, and efforts were anchored by the Organisational Session held on March 3, 2025 at the UN Headquarters in New York, where initial inputs and proposals on dialogue themes were formally gathered, followed by a month-long online consultation process during which contributions and recommendations from all stakeholder groups were carefully reviewed and integrated into the development of the final themes for the interactive six themes officially adopted for the interactive dialogues are:* Water for People* Water for Prosperity* Water for Planet* Water for Cooperation* Water in Multilateral Processes* Investments for WaterAssistant Minister of Foreign Affairs for Energy and Sustainability, Abdulla Balalaa, stated, 'Water connects us all, and our actions must reflect that shared responsibility.' He added, 'This Conference is our moment to course-correct - to set the world on a pathway of accelerated, coordinated, and sustained water action. To demonstrate progress on clean water and access, we must leverage investments, innovation, and partnerships to secure a sustainable water future for all.'Following this milestone, the UAE and Senegal will begin the co-chairs selection process for each of the interactive selected co-chairs, working in close collaboration with the co-hosts and other stakeholders, will play a key role in shaping the thematic discussions and desired outcomes of the Conference. This selection process will conclude prior to the next major preparatory milestone scheduled to take place in Dakar, Senegal, on January 26-27, week in New York also featured a series of high-level meetings and engagements to advance the UAE's preparations and international collaboration in the lead-up to hosting the 2026 UN Water Conference, co-hosted by the UAE and Senegal, will be held in the UAE in December of next Conference aims to accelerate action toward the achievement of SDG6 and mobilise global efforts to ensure the availability and sustainable management of water and sanitation for all. As of today, 2.2 billion lack access to clean drinking water and 3.5 billion lack access to sanitation, making the 2026 UN Water Conference a timely convening for accelerating global water action.
